Paul reveals the incredible truth of redemption:
Galatians 3:13 – “Christ redeemed us from the curse of the law by becoming a curse for us.”
Jesus took upon Himself the curse of sin so that we could receive freedom and righteousness. The weight of this sacrifice should humble us and fill us with gratitude.
Reflection Questions:
- What does it mean to you personally that Christ took on the curse of sin for you?
- How does this truth shape your relationship with Him?
- How does understanding what Christ has done deepen your gratitude and joy?
